Alcott Park is a beautiful green space located at 3751 South 97th Street in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. This park offers a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life, with plenty of open space for picnics, sports, and leisurely strolls. The park features playgrounds for children, walking trails, and lush greenery perfect for relaxation and unwinding. Visitors can also enjoy the fresh air and natural surroundings while taking in the scenic views of the surrounding area. Alcott Park is a perfect destination for families, nature lovers, and anyone looking to escape to a tranquil outdoor oasis in the heart of Milwaukee.

"This is a great neighborhood park. The free wading pool is perfect for young children and is open 1-5pm. The playground is adjacent to the pool which is nice if you have older kids who aren't interested in the pool. Shade is limited inside the pool area, but the pool is rarely busy enough that you cannot get shade at some point during your time there."
